Two Brothers Couldn’t Share Their Grandfather’s Inheritance Until the Old Man Told Them a Wise Way to Do It

John and Matt, two brothers who had spent their lives in rivalry, faced a new challenge when their beloved Grandfather Dudus passed away. The old man had left them a substantial inheritance, but with a twist: they had to agree on a fair split before they could access it.

Growing up, John and Matt were always at odds. Their competitive nature led to frequent arguments, from childhood squabbles to adult resentments. Despite their parents’ attempts to foster harmony and Grandfather Dudus’s wisdom urging them to value each other, the brothers remained divided.

When Dudus passed, the inheritance included a house, land, a car, and a substantial sum of money. At the lawyer’s office, Mr. Campbell revealed that the brothers could only claim the inheritance if they could agree on how to divide it fairly, without complaints.

John immediately voiced his frustration. “I deserve more. I took care of Grandpa more than Matt did.”

Matt countered, “I visited him regularly. You weren’t around.”

Their argument grew heated, and Mr. Campbell’s attempts to mediate only fueled their anger. “Is this how you want to remember Grandpa?” he asked, urging them to reflect on their grandfather’s legacy.

After a week of bitter disputes and no resolution, the brothers encountered a homeless man who overheard their argument. The man shared a parable about two men dividing land: one would divide the land, and the other would choose first. The divider would ensure fairness since he wouldn’t want to choose last.

Inspired by the story, John and Matt decided to try the same approach. John would divide the inheritance, and Matt would choose first.

Back in John’s living room, they carefully divided the assets: the house, land, car, and money. When John finished, Matt chose one of the divisions. They managed to divide the inheritance equitably, respecting each other’s choices.

Returning to Mr. Campbell’s office, the brothers presented their decision. The lawyer was impressed with their fairness and noted that it was a testament to Dudus’s wisdom.

John and Matt signed the documents, their relationship transformed. They shook hands, acknowledging their progress. “Let’s make this work,” John said sincerely.

Matt agreed. “For Grandpa.”

As they left the office, they felt a newfound respect for each other. “I never thought we’d work together,” John said.

Matt smiled. “Me neither. But it feels good.”

In the end, Grandfather Dudus’s legacy wasn’t just the inheritance, but the reconciliation and understanding between his grandsons.
